>>I want to know what are the drives in my computer. Perhaps there's a vfp function that would tell me that but I don't remember.
>
>You have the DRIVETYPE() function:
>
>? DRIVETYPE("C")
>3

Looks kind of useless - returns 1 for nonexistent drives. Which is supposed to mean "no type" - but then, well, at least it doesn't error out and the difference between an absent disk and unknown type disk is irrelevant: you can't get anything from such a disk anyway.
